Isolated Non Hodgkin Lymphoma of the Base of Tongue –A Case Report
Journal Title: Journal of Medical Science And clinical Research - Year 2018, Vol 6, Issue 6
Abstract
Majority of Non Hodgkin Lymphoma (NHL) cases present as peripheral lymphadenopathy. Here we report a rare case which presented as an isolated growth in the base of tongue without any other signs or symptoms and mimicked squamous cell carcinoma. So far very few cases of isolated incidence of base of tongue NHL are reported. With the histopathological examination and use of IHC marker, we arrived at the diagnosis of NHL of DLBCL (Diffuse Large B Cell Lymphoma) type.
